With international travel unlikely to return for some time yet, your 2021 holiday plans probably include vacationing somewhere within Australia. If heading to the country’s southern-most state is on your list, and you’re keen to do so via car, then you’ll welcome the Federal Government’s temporary expansion of the Bass Strait Passenger Vehicle Equalisation Schemebecause it’s letting travellers take their wheels to Tassie via ferry for a four month period without paying extra.
